Door Handle Lock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

Door manages and their locks are necessary parts of any functioning door. They offer not just a way of access however also use security to homes and services. With time, wear and tear can jeopardize the functionality and security of these systems. This article will guide you through the process of door handle lock replacement, covering needed tools, actions, and frequently asked questions.

Why Replace a Door Handle Lock?

There are a number of reasons one may require to replace a door handle lock, including:

  • Wear and Tear: Over time, locks can deteriorate, making them difficult to operate or inefficient in providing security.
  • Lost Keys: If secrets are lost, it is vital to replace the lock to guarantee security and security.
  • Break-ins or Vandalism: If a lock has actually been tampered with, changing it is a critical action in restoring security.
  • Upgrading Style: Property owners may want to update the visual of their doors with more modern designs or surfaces.

Tools Needed for Door Handle Lock Replacement

Before beginning the replacement process, collect the following tools:

Tool Description
Screwdriver Usually a flat-head or Phillips screwdriver
Replacement Lock Set A new door handle lock compatible with your door
Drill (if essential) For producing holes if the existing ones are misaligned
Measuring tape For determining the door and guaranteeing appropriate fit
Allen Wrench Typically required for particular handle types
Safety Goggles To safeguard eyes from particles while working

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ing a Door Handle Lock

Step 1: Gather Materials

Guarantee you have all the necessary tools and your replacement lock easily offered. Validate that the new lock is compatible with your door type.

Action 2: Remove the Old Lock

  1. Unscrew the Handle: Locate the screws holding the handle in place, usually found on the interior side of the door. Use the screwdriver to remove them.

  2. Detach the Lock Cylinder: If your lock is a separate cylinder, pull it out carefully after getting rid of the handle.

  3. Remove the Strike Plate: Unscrew the plate on the door frame where the bolt sits when the door is closed.

Step 3: Measure for Proper Fit

Utilize the measuring tape to check measurements, such as the density of your door and the distance in between the lock hole and other functions (like the edge of the door). This ensures the new lock aligns correctly.

Step 4: Install the New Lock

  1. Place the Lock Cylinder: If the new lock comes with a cylinder, insert it into the designated hole from the exterior side of the door.

  2. Attach the New Handle: Align the new handle with the lock utilizing the provided screws. Tighten up the screws safely.

  3. Repair the Strike Plate: Reattach the strike plate with screws, making certain it aligns with the bolt mechanism of your lock.

Step 5: Test the Lock

Thoroughly test the handle and key functions to make sure that the lock operates efficiently. Open and close the door numerous times to look for proper positioning and function.

Upkeep Tips for Door Handle Locks

  • Lubrication: Periodically apply graphite lubricant to the lock to ensure smooth operation.
  • Evaluation: Regularly check for indications of wear, rust, or damage.

Frequently Asked Questions About Door Handle Lock Replacement

Q1: How do I know if I need to replace my door handle lock?A: Look
for indications of difficulty in turning the secret, physical damage to the lock, or if the handle feels loose. If you’ve lost your secrets, it’s likewise a great indication for replacement.

Q2: Can I replace the lock myself?A: Yes, with the right tools and instructions, most individuals can change a door handle lock themselves. Q3: How long does the replacement process take?A: Typically, lock replacement can take anywhere from 15 minutes to an hour, depending on the intricacy of the lock and your experience level. Q4: What if my door has a special size or shape?A: Many hardware shops carry a variety of locks

fit to various door sizes. If you have a distinct door, think about speaking with a locksmith professional. Q5: Are there any security features I ought to consider in a new lock?A: Yes, look for locks with features such
